CRYSTAL STRUCTURE OF THE HUMAN RXR ALPHA LIGAND BINDING DOMAIN BOUND TO 9-CIS RETINOIC ACID
Summary for 1FBY
Entry DOI | 10.2210/pdb1fby/pdb |
Descriptor | RETINOIC ACID RECEPTOR RXR-ALPHA, (9cis)-retinoic acid (3 entities in total) |
Functional Keywords | nuclear receptor, protein-ligand complex, retinoid receptor, transcription |
Biological source | Homo sapiens (human) |
Cellular location | Nucleus : P19793 |
Total number of polymer chains | 2 |
Total formula weight | 54110.75 |
Authors | Egea, P.F.,Mitschler, A.,Rochel, N.,Ruff, M.,Chambon, P.,Moras, D. (deposition date: 2000-07-17, release date: 2000-07-28, Last modification date: 2024-02-07) |
Primary citation | Egea, P.F.,Mitschler, A.,Rochel, N.,Ruff, M.,Chambon, P.,Moras, D. Crystal structure of the human RXRalpha ligand-binding domain bound to its natural ligand: 9-cis retinoic acid. EMBO J., 19:2592-2601, 2000 Cited by PubMed: 10835357DOI: 10.1093/emboj/19.11.2592 PDB entries with the same primary citation |
Experimental method | X-RAY DIFFRACTION (2.25 Å) |
